腾讯云轻量应用服务器系统选择指南
结论先行
对于大多数用户,推荐选择 Ubuntu LTS 或 CentOS Stream,具体取决于你的技术栈和运维习惯。 Ubuntu 适合开发者,生态丰富;CentOS Stream 适合企业级稳定需求;Windows Server 仅限特定场景(如.NET开发)。
主流系统对比与推荐
1. Ubuntu LTS(推荐多数用户)
- 优势:
- 长期支持(LTS版本稳定更新5年),适合长期运维。
- 软件生态丰富,apt 包管理工具高效,兼容最新开发工具(如 Docker、Python、Node.js)。
- 社区活跃,问题解决快,教程资源多。
- 适用场景:Web 服务(Nginx/Apache)、云原生应用、个人开发者。
- 注意点:非 LTS 版本(如 22.10)不建议生产环境使用。
核心建议:选择 Ubuntu 22.04 LTS,平衡稳定性和新特性支持。
2. CentOS Stream(替代传统CentOS)
- 优势:
- 作为RHEL上游版本,稳定性接近企业级需求。
- yum/dnf 包管理,兼容传统 CentOS 运维习惯。
- 劣势:
- 非“固定版本”,滚动更新可能引入兼容性问题。
- 社区支持弱于 Ubuntu。
- 适用场景:企业服务、数据库(MySQL/PostgreSQL)、需RHEL兼容的环境。
核心建议:若需RHEL生态但无严格合规要求,CentOS Stream 9是优选。
3. Debian(轻量稳定之选)
- 优势:
- 极简且稳定,资源占用低,适合低配置服务器。
- apt 包管理,软件版本较保守(减少冲突)。
- 劣势:软件版本较旧,新功能支持延迟。
- 适用场景:老旧设备、防火墙/NAS等轻量服务。
4. Windows Server(特定需求)
- 优势:
- 支持 ASP.NET、MSSQL、远程桌面(RDP) 等微软技术栈。
- 劣势:
- 授权费用高(需额外购买许可证)。
- 资源占用大,性能劣于 Linux。
- 适用场景:企业级.NET应用、Active Directory服务。
避坑指南
- 避免选择非LTS版本或小众系统(如Arch Linux),生产环境需保障稳定性。
- 镜像大小影响启动速度:Windows镜像通常超过10GB,Linux仅1-2GB。
- 国内网络优化:腾讯云默认提供国内提速源,但CentOS需手动替换yum源。
最终建议
- 个人开发者/初创公司:Ubuntu 22.04 LTS(开箱即用,文档齐全)。
- 企业传统服务:CentOS Stream 9(RHEL兼容性+腾讯云优化)。
- 极致轻量/嵌入式:Debian 11。
- 必须Windows环境:Windows Server 2019/2022(确认授权成本)。
记住:系统选择的核心是匹配业务需求,而非盲目追求“最新”或“流行”。